3. How request builders work

The current request builders run in the visitor’s browser. This website does not send or store the form submission on its own server. After the visitor reviews the draft and chooses to continue, the text is placed into a WhatsApp link and is then handled by WhatsApp under its own terms and privacy practices.

A prepared message may appear in the WhatsApp link, browser history or device activity. Remove anything sensitive before continuing.

5. Cookies, analytics and technical logs

The website code in this release does not intentionally set analytics or advertising cookies. The hosting provider may process standard request information, such as IP address, browser type, requested URL, date/time and security events, to deliver and protect the website.

If analytics is added later, this policy and any required consent controls must be updated before tracking begins.
